Environmental Engineer, Environmental Compliance & Protection
My Client is the EPCM contractor for the largest known lithium resource in the United States. Once complete, the mine and processing facilities will produce more lithium carbonate than any other facility in the United States by far, enough to power 1 million electric vehicles per year. As the EPCM contractor the client is responsible for managing and integrating the efforts of a team contractors engineering and building the facility.
Earth work began in 2023 and design and procurement of long-lead equipment is underway.
The project is located in the high desert,1 hour northwest of Winnemucca. The role is 100% on site and will be a 57 hour work week, overtime is paid after the first 40 hours. A per diem is offered along with mobilization, demobilization and trips home covered.
In this role, you will support the preparation and implementation of a project Environmental Management Plan and supervise a team to support plan integration and execution. You will work with functional leads, evaluate performance trends, and provide technical guidance on mitigation measures. Your leadership will ensure protection of environmentally sensitive areas, species, and communities.
